Senior Product Designer, Fleet ExperienceWho we areGeotab® is a global leader in IoT and connected transportation and certified “Great Place to Work™.” We are a company of diverse and talented individuals who work together to help businesses grow and succeed, and increase the safety and sustainability of our communities.Geotab is advancing security, connecting commercial vehicles to the internet and providing web-based analytics to help customers better manage their fleets. Geotab’s open platform and Geotab Marketplace®, offering hundreds of third‑party solution options, allows both small and large businesses to automate operations by integrating vehicle data with their other data assets. Processing billions of data points a day, Geotab leverages data analytics and machine learning to improve productivity, optimize fleets through the reduction of fuel consumption, enhance driver safety and achieve solid compliance to regulatory changes.Who you areWe are looking for a Senior Product Designer who will play a critical role in driving user‑centered design, leading initiatives from initial discovery through to implementation. This role will focus specifically on our MyAdmin platform, a complex customer management tool for billing, device management, returns, and support tickets. You will need to work with vast amounts of data and interact with multiple different user personas. If you love technology and are keen to join an industry leader, we would love to hear from you.What you’ll doAs a Senior Product Designer, your key area of responsibility is contributing to the product design vision, collaborating with the design team, and working with other designers to simplify complexity and build features customers ask for. You will work closely with cross‑functional teams including Product Management, Product Ops, Development, Customer Success, and Data Science to lead discovery and research, focusing on creating and evolving user personas and journey maps to define and optimize the customer management experience within the platform.To be successful,



you will be a self‑starter and a strong storyteller with great initiative, emphasizing design as a strategic asset to help improve the organization’s design capabilities. You will have strong analytical and systematic design skills, the ability to identify needs, develop effective solutions, and manage projects through completion. You will also manage multiple timelines and contrasting priorities to ensure timely results.How you’ll make an impactDrive design initiatives in cross‑functional teams, promoting collaboration and ensuring seamless integration of design solutions throughout the product development lifecycle.Take a proactive role in identifying opportunities to enhance design capabilities and effectiveness, initiating improvements in design methodologies, tools, and workflows to optimize efficiency and deliver exceptional user experiences.Lead efforts in building and maintaining a scalable component library, ensuring consistency across the product, and regularly updating documentation to reflect design system changes.Conduct research, user testing, and analysis to gain deep insights into user behaviors, preferences, and pain points, guiding the development of user‑centered design solutions.Share knowledge within the design team, mentoring and supporting junior designers to foster professional growth and excellence.Advise your manager on user‑centric design principles and best practices, ensuring that design solutions align with user needs and industry standards.Gather requirements and align design efforts with business objectives, actively seeking opportunities to improve the overall product experience.Stay up‑to‑date with industry trends, emerging technologies, and design best practices,



continuously evolving design skills and knowledge.Advise on design concepts and communicate ideas effectively to stakeholders, presenting design solutions and justifying design decisions based on user research and data.Work independently with developers and product managers to ensure successful implementation of design solutions, providing guidance and support throughout the development process.What you’ll bring to the role3‑5 years of relevant industry experience.Proficiency in UI design and collaborative tools including Figma, Figmake, Figjam (or equivalents), and familiarity with AI‑assisted design tools such as Claude Code, Lovable, or UX Pilot.Deep knowledge of product design and design systems, including the ability to create, maintain, and scale component libraries and documentation.Experience in the user‑centered design process, from conducting research and facilitating workshops to high‑level design strategy and implementation.Strong technical competence with tools such as Google Suite and a working understanding of front‑end development (React, HTML, CSS) to collaborate effectively with engineering.Excellent communication skills with the ability to tell stories and communicate complex ideas or goals to stakeholders across all levels of the organization.Flexibility to travel (USA and Europe).Why job seekers choose GeotabFlex working arrangementsHome office reimbursement programBaby bonus & parental leave top‑up programOnline learning and networking opportunitiesElectric vehicle purchase incentive programCompetitive medical and dental benefitsRetirement savings program*The above are offered to full‑time permanent employees only.Geotab encourages applications from all qualified individuals. We are committed to accommodating people with disabilities during the recruitment and assessment processes and when employees are hired. We will ensure the accessibility needs of employees with disabilities are taken into account as part of performance management, career development, training and redeployment processes.Hiring Range: $104,400 - $135,700 CAD#J-18808-Ljbffr
